This book provides an introduction to the principles of structural
engineering using a problem-based approach. It covers the basic
concepts of structural analysis and design, including statics,
strength of materials, and mechanics of materials. The text emphasizes
the application of these principles to real-world structural
engineering problems and includes numerous example problems and case
studies to illustrate key concepts. The problem-based approach helps
students develop their problem-solving skills, critical thinking
abilities, and intuition for structural engineering. Fundamentals of
Structural Engineering: A Problem-Based Approach is designed for
undergraduate students studying structural engineering or related
fields. Covers all the key concepts in structural engineering,
including statics, strength of materials, mechanics of materials, load
estimation, and analysis techniques. Utilizes a problem-based approach
that helps students understand and apply the principles of structural
engineering in a practical, hands-on way. Includes numerous worked
examples, practice problems, and case studies that provide students
with a clear understanding of how the concepts they have learned can
be applied to real-world structural engineering problems.
